WebJan 4, 2024 · Answer. The tabernacle built by Moses and, later, Solomon’s temple were divided into the Holy Place and the Most Holy Place (or Holy of Holies ). To understand these places, it will help if we first understand the concept of “holy.”. At its most basic meaning, holy simply means “set apart” or even “different.”. WebThe Holy of Holies was located at the west end of the Temple, and in Solomon's Temple it enshrined the Ark of the Covenant, a symbol of Israel's special relationship with God. At the entrance to the Holy of Holies stood a small cedar altar overlaid with gold.
